The shirts are color coded to show the form of abuse and whether
the victim survived the abuse they experienced.
White represents women who died because of violence;
Yellow or beige represents battered
or assaulted women;
Red, pink, and orange are for survivors of rape and sexual assault;
Blue and green t-shirts
represent survivors of incest and sexual abuse;
Purple or lavender represents
women attacked because of their sexual orientation;
Black is for women attacked for political reasons.
